A scenic urban waterfront path connecting Boston's historic harborside neighborhoods.

The Boston Harborwalk is a continuous public walkway stretching along the city's shoreline. It connects waterfront neighborhoods including the Seaport, North End, Downtown, and Charlestown, offering access to public parks, piers, and beaches. Visitors can enjoy panoramic skyline views, public art, historic sites, and waterfront dining along the route.

Quick tip: Wear comfortable walking shoes and explore in segments, as the walkway covers miles across multiple distinct neighborhoods.
